<B>1916-D 10C MS64 Full Bands PCGS.</B></I> Along with the Lincoln cent and the Buffalo nickel, the Mercury dime one of the three series most frequently associated with Whitman folder collecting by the baby-boom generation of numismatists. Most collectors who tackled the series wound up with a few unfilled holes, possibly the 1921 and 1921-D issues or some elusive early S-mints. The space that bedeviled all but a select few, however, was the one meant for the 1916-D dime.<BR> This Choice Full Bands example has the potential to fulfill a collector's dream. The strike is undeniably bold, with excellent separation on the bands of the fasces. The softly lustrous surfaces offer whispers of green-gold patina, and the overall eye appeal is excellent. In sum, an incredibly attractive survivor for the grade assigned.<BR><I>From The Scheppman Collection, #4 PCGS Registry of Full Band Mercury Dimes.
